EBAM additive manufacturing involves the use of an electron beam to melt and solidify metal powders layer by layer, ultimately creating a three-dimensional object The process begins with a Computer-Aided Design (CAD) file that is sliced into thin layers, which are then sent to the EBAM machine for fabrication The high-energy electron beam selectively melts the metal powder, fusing it together to form the desired shape This revolutionary technology allows for the creation of intricate and complex geometries that would be impossible to achieve using traditional manufacturing methods.
One of the key advantages of EBAM additive manufacturing is its versatility in working with a wide range of metals, including titanium, aluminum, stainless steel, and nickel-based alloys This flexibility allows manufacturers to choose the material best suited for their specific application, resulting in stronger, lighter, and more durable parts Additionally, the ability to control the heat input during the manufacturing process ensures minimal distortion and residual stresses, leading to parts with superior mechanical properties.
